Smooth leather watch straps
Care

Superficial scratches or abrasions can be removed with a little colorless leather grease. Minor scuff marks can also be removed by gently rubbing the leather with a finger. Matte-coated leather is generally more susceptible to wear and may darken slightly over time. This effect contributes to the vintage look and is intentional. Re-greasing leather will keep your strap supple and water-resistant.

Special features

When you first bend the leather bracelet, the color may temporarily lighten. This effect will disappear with wear. It can also be immediately removed by moistening it. Leather is a natural product that softens after the first few uses, thus conforming to the shape of your wrist.

NATO straps made their grand debut in 1973. Due to their extremely high durability, the straps were designated standard for soldiers by the British Ministry of Defence that year. The extremely durable and water-resistant nylon material used as a continuous band makes it almost impossible to tear the watch off your wrist. Today, NATO straps are experiencing a revival in a wide variety of colors and designs. They are also very popular for an authentic vintage look.

What makes NATO straps special is that they consist of a single, continuous band, making them much more secure on the wrist. Direct skin contact with the watch case is largely avoided. They are also intentionally longer, allowing you to fold the end of the strap and slide it into the last ring if desired (see photo).

Marble
Marble is a natural limestone that developed a crystalline structure under pressure deep within the Earth. This marbling can vary greatly, ranging from very fine to coarse strands. As a limestone that was subjected to high pressure, marble also often contains small air pockets. This makes each marble floor unique. Marble is sensitive to acids, so it should not come into contact with strong cleaning agents or other acidic substances (e.g., wine, vinegar, citrus fruits).

Band width (lug width)

The width determines whether the strap fits the watch. The strap width (also called lug width) can be determined using a centimeter ruler between the two strap attachments on the watch case. Most watches have a strap width between 18 and 22 mm, with 20 mm being the most common.
Our graphic shows you exactly where the width is measured on the watch. We offer in our Online Shop These three most common band widths are usually available for each bracelet.
